What are the clinical manifestations of primary dysmenorrhea?

Dysmenorrhea is a common physiological phenomenon in women. There are many causes for dysmenorrhea. Dysmenorrhea can be divided into primary and secondary. So what are the clinical manifestations of primary dysmenorrhea ? The following is a detailed answer from relevant experts.

Lower abdominal pain is often crampy or strangulating, but may also be persistent and dull and radiate to the back or legs. The pain may begin before or during menstruation, peak 24 hours later, and often subside after 2 days. Sometimes there are endometrial casts (membranous dysmenorrhea) or blood clots. Common clinical manifestations of primary dysmenorrhea include headaches, nausea, constipation or diarrhea, and frequent urination. PMS symptoms may persist for part or all of the menstrual period.

Primary pain often occurs in young women a few months after menarche (6 to 12 months), and the incidence begins to decrease after the age of 30. Pain often begins just before or after menstruation and lasts for the first 48 to 72 hours of menstruation. The pain is often spasmodic and sometimes so severe that bed rest is required for hours or days. The pain is concentrated in the middle of the lower abdomen, sometimes accompanied by back pain or radiating to the inner thigh. Pelvic examination shows no positive findings.
